Massive Potomac sewage spill could take months to clean up
NBC News· 2026-02-18 00:24
The river George Washington called the nation's river is tonight off limits and contaminated after a 60-year-old sewage line in Maryland broke open last month, spewing more than 240 million gallons of raw waste into the river. Sen. Lindsey Graham pushes for more intervention in Iran amid nuclear talks
NBC News· 2026-02-18 00:07
In Geneva today, US envoys and Iranian officials try to narrow big disagreements over Thran's remaining nuclear program and expanding missile force with Oman playing middleman. Both sides report progress, but there are huge gaps and each are backing up their diplomacy with a show of force.
